The cost of 4 books is Rs. 200. Find the cost of one book.

To find the cost of one book when the total cost of 4 books is Rs. 200, we can follow these steps:

1. Identify the total cost and the number of books: We are given that the total cost for 4 books is Rs. 200.

2. Determine what we need to find: We need to find the cost of one book.

3. Set up the equation:
- Let the cost of one book be `x`.
- Since there are 4 books, the total cost is represented by `4 x`.

4. Use the given total cost to form the equation:
- Given total cost = Rs. 200
- Therefore, the equation becomes: `4
x = 200`.

5. Solve for `x`:
- To find the value of `x`, we divide both sides of the equation by 4:
[tex]\[ x = \frac{200}{4} \][/tex]

6. Calculate the division:
- [tex]\( \frac{200}{4} = 50 \)[/tex].

Hence, the cost of one book is Rs. 50.
